Fuel Cell: Working Principle, Characteristics, Systems, Advantages

The process involves breaking the chemical bonds in the gases (H 2 and O 2), which absorb energy. New bonds are formed in the water molecule, which releases energy, and the system becomes stable at a lower energy. The free energy of the system has decreased and has appeared as heat and light from the reaction.

Understanding the Working Principle of Batteries

What is the working principle of batteries? Batteries work by converting chemical energy into electrical energy. This is accomplished through a process called electrochemical reaction. The battery consists of two electrodes – a positive electrode (cathode) and a negative electrode (anode) – immersed in an electrolyte solution.

Battery Working Principle: How Batteries Generate and Store

Batteries work on the principle of electrochemical reactions, where the conversion of chemical energy into electrical energy occurs. This process is facilitated by the flow of current. Inside a battery, there are two electrodes: a positive electrode known as the cathode and a negative electrode known as the anode.

Why do we need a new battery chemistry?

These should have more energy and performance, and be manufactured on a sustainable material basis. They should also be safer and more cost-effective and should already consider end-of-life aspects and recycling in the design. Therefore, it is necessary to accelerate the further development of new and improved battery chemistries and cells.
